Domain Information

The extracted domain name is pairminer.com. According to WHOIS data, the domain was registered in 2022, which could indicate it’s a relatively new operation. The registrant’s information is not publicly available due to privacy protection services, which can sometimes be a legitimate measure but also raises suspicions when combined with other red flags.

Website Overview

Upon visiting pairminer.com, the site presents itself as a cryptocurrency mining platform, promising high returns on investment with minimal effort. The design is sleek and modern, attempting to convey a sense of professionalism and legitimacy. However, upon closer inspection, several red flags become apparent:

  • The site lacks detailed information about the company, its physical location, or the team behind it, which is unusual for a legitimate investment platform.
  • There are spelling errors and awkwardly phrased sentences in the content, suggesting a lack of professional oversight.
  • The testimonials section features overly positive and generic reviews without specific details, which could indicate they are fabricated.

Scam Indicators

Several indicators suggest pairminer.com could be a scam:

  1. Unrealistic Offers or Promises: The website promises unusually high and consistent returns, which is a common trait among Ponzi schemes or scams. Legitimate investment platforms always emphasize the risks and variability of returns.
  2. Fake Testimonials or Reviews: As mentioned, the testimonials appear fake, lacking specificity and realism, which undermines the site’s credibility.
  3. Lack of Contact Details or Fake Addresses: There is no physical address provided, and the contact page only offers an email address, which could be unmonitored or used solely for scam purposes.
  4. Unsecure Payment Systems or Requests for Personal/Banking Info: The site asks for cryptocurrency investment directly into wallets, which can be a secure method but lacks the transparency and regulatory compliance expected from legitimate investment platforms.
  5. Duplicate or Plagiarized Content: Parts of the website’s content seem to be copied from other sources without proper citation, further diminishing its credibility.

User Warnings

Users should exercise extreme caution when dealing with pairminer.com. Here are some precautions:

  • Verify Information: Always verify the information provided by the website through independent sources.
  • Be Wary of Unrealistic Promises: No investment platform can guarantee high returns with little to no risk.
  • Check for Regulation: Ensure the platform is regulated by relevant financial authorities, which pairminer.com does not appear to be.
  • Secure Your Financial Information: Never invest more than you can afford to lose, and use secure, traceable payment methods.

Verdict

Based on the analysis, pairminer.com exhibits multiple red flags commonly associated with scam operations. The lack of transparency, unrealistic promises, and potential for fraudulent activities make it highly suspicious. It is recommended that users avoid this site entirely, as the risks of financial loss are significant. The absence of legitimate regulatory oversight and the site’s anonymity further support the conclusion that pairminer.com is likely a scam. Users should always prioritize caution and conduct thorough research before engaging with any investment platform.
